
云服务器(ECS)和轻量应用服务器是当今互联网时代的两种常见的服务架构。它们都是基于云计算技术的一种服务形式,通过虚拟化技术将服务器资源进行抽象化,并提供弹性扩展、高可靠性、低成本等优势。本文将从定义、特点、优势、应用场景等方面对云服务器(ECS)和轻量应用服务器进行分析比较。
一、云服务器(ECS)概述
云服务器(Elastic Compute Service,ECS)是阿里云推出的一种弹性计算服务,它提供了一台或多台计算资源并允许在云上部署和运行应用程序。云服务器可以根据实际需求弹性扩展或缩减计算资源,通过自动化管理和调度技术实现高可靠性、高性能和低成本的服务。
云服务器(ECS)具有以下特点:
弹性伸缩:云服务器可以根据用户的实际需求,快速增加或减少计算资源,实现弹性伸缩,避免资源闲置浪费。
高可靠性:云服务器通过数据冗余和容错机制来保证应用的高可靠性,故障自动迁移和快速恢复。
自动化管理:云服务器提供了自动化的管理和调度功能,用户无需关注底层硬件和网络环境,只需集中精力于应用程序的开发和维护。
多机型选择:云服务器提供多种机型选择,包括通用型、内存型、存储型、GPU型等,满足不同应用场景和需求。
安全和数据隔离:云服务器提供严密的安全防护措施,包括网络隔离、安全组、访问控制等,保障用户数据安全。
二、轻量应用服务器概述
轻量应用服务器是一种基于容器技术的轻量级计算服务,它以轻量、快速启动、低资源消耗为特点。轻量应用服务器通过虚拟化技术将应用程序和相关依赖项封装为容器,并提供高性能的运行环境。
轻量应用服务器具有以下特点:
轻量:轻量应用服务器采用容器技术,应用程序和相关依赖项被封装为容器,具有较小的体积和较低的资源消耗。
快速启动:由于容器技术的特性,轻量应用服务器可以快速启动,并且可以实现快速部署和扩展。
灵活性:轻量应用服务器可以根据实际需求进行快速部署和迁移,实现弹性伸缩和高可用性。
高性能:轻量应用服务器采用容器技术,可以在不同的运行环境中提供高性能的计算服务。
开发和部署效率高:轻量应用服务器提供了简化的部署和管理工具,可以提高开发和部署效率。
三、云服务器(ECS)和轻量应用服务器的优势对比
弹性伸缩能力:云服务器(ECS)具有弹性伸缩的能力,可以根据实际需求快速调整计算资源,而轻量应用服务器一般需要手动进行部署和扩展。
开发和部署效率:轻量应用服务器具有快速部署和迁移的特点,能够提高开发和部署效率,而云服务器(ECS)需要更多的配置和管理步骤。
成本控制:云服务器(ECS)提供了多种机型选择,用户可以根据需求选择适合的机型和配置,而轻量应用服务器一般以低成本、高性能为主,可以节省运维和维护成本。
安全性和可靠性:云服务器(ECS)提供了严密的安全防护措施和数据隔离,可以保障数据的安全性和系统的可靠性,而轻量应用服务器相对较弱,需要根据具体需求进行防护措施的加强。
四、云服务器(ECS)和轻量应用服务器的应用场景
云服务器(ECS)适用于以下场景:
网站和应用的部署:云服务器(ECS)提供了丰富的机型选择和高可靠性的计算资源,适合于中小型网站和应用的部署和运行。
大规模数据处理和分析:云服务器(ECS)可以根据实际需求快速调整计算资源,提供高性能的计算环境,适合大规模数据处理和分析的应用场景。
游戏服务器:云服务器(ECS)提供了高性能和可靠性的计算资源,适合于游戏服务器的部署和运行。
轻量应用服务器适用于以下场景:
微服务架构:轻量应用服务器的轻量特性和快速启动能力,适合于微服务架构的部署和运行。
容器化应用部署:轻量应用服务器以容器为单位进行部署和管理,适合于容器化应用的部署和运行。
高并发应用:轻量应用服务器的高性能和快速启动能力,适合于高并发应用的部署和运行。
五、结论
云服务器(ECS)和轻量应用服务器是基于云计算技术的两种常见的服务架构,它们都具有一定的优势和适用场景。根据具体的需求,选择合适的服务形式可以提高应用的性能和效率,实现成本控制和安全保障。在实际应用中,可以根据需求的变化和业务的发展,灵活运用云服务器(ECS)和轻量应用服务器,提供更稳定、可靠、高效的计算服务。
以上就是关于“云服务器ecs和轻量应用服务器”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m